Lisa’s Beaded Scrunchie by Lisa Schmidt ©

Materials:
White Worsted weight cotton yarn (approx. 1 oz)
40 Red Tri-beads
Size H hook
Yarn needle
Elastic Hair band

Note:  Thread beads onto cotton yarn before beginning.  Use either a bead threader or a small (size 10) steel hook.  Using the steel hook, thread 3 beads onto end of hook, and loop cotton yarn over hook and pull through beads.

Round 1: Join with a sc around hair band and work 39 more sc completely around band, join with sl st to first sc.  (40 sc)

Round 2:  Ch 3, (dc in same st, ch 1, 2 dc) in same sp, * (2 dc, ch 1, 2dc) in next space.  Repeat from * around, join with sl st to top of ch 3.

Round 3:  Sl st to first ch 1 sp, (ch1, sc) in same sp, bring bead up to hook ch 1 over bead, sc in same sp, ch 3, * (sc, ch1 over bead, sc in next sp), ch 3.  Repeat from * around.  Join with sl st to first sc.  Fasten Off and weave in ends.

Variation:  On Round 1 work (2 dc, ch 2, 2dc) ch 1 in each stitch.  This makes an even fuller scrunchie.
